What Is a Windmill Generator Science Project?


A windmill generator science project is a model that demonstrates how wind energy is converted into electrical energy. It consists of blades, a shaft, and a small generator unit.
The rotation of blades converts wind energy into mechanical motion. This mechanical energy is then converted into electrical energy using a generator. This process illustrates the fundamentals of renewable energy systems.
The simplicity of a wind energy project makes it suitable for students of different age groups.

How a Windmill Generator Works


The working of a wind energy project is based on converting wind energy into electrical energy. Air movement spins the turbine blades, generating motion.
This rotation drives a shaft connected to a generator. Electricity is produced using electromagnetic principles. This enables the wind turbine model project to produce usable electricity.
Performance is influenced by environmental conditions and construction. Understanding these factors improves project outcomes.

Components Required for Windmill Generator Science Project


A wind energy project requires several components. Important elements include turbine blades, a generator, connecting wires, and a support structure.
Blades capture wind energy and convert it into motion. The generator produces electrical output from mechanical energy. Electrical connections enable energy flow.
Every part contributes to the functioning of the wind energy experiment. Knowledge of materials improves construction accuracy.

Procedure for Construction


Building a windmill generator science project involves a step-by-step process. The first step is designing and constructing the blades.
The blades are fixed to a rotating shaft linked to a generator. Electrical connections are established for output measurement. The model is secured to ensure proper functioning.
Running the project under wind conditions verifies its efficiency. This step confirms the functionality of the windmill generator science project.
